"Lucky Pregnant Wife: Good Night, Master Zhan!" It was a super popular romance novel by Yan An. The story was about the female protagonist, Luo Shihan, who was reborn and married her lover, Zhan Hanjue, whom she had a crush on in her previous life. Luo Shihan plotted to sleep with Zhan Hanjue and escape after getting pregnant with his child, which angered Lord Zhan. However, in the end, Lord Zhan returned to Luo Shihan's side and expressed his willingness to accept her conditions. The plot of this novel was full of ups and downs, and it was thrilling. " Da Feng's Watchmen, a benevolent father and filial son " was an online catchphrase. It came from Qidian Chinese Network's online novel, Da Feng's Watchmen.
The meaning of this phrase was that Xu Qi 'an and his son were both' hypocrites 'of the Great Feng Dynasty. On the surface, they were kind and filial, but behind their backs, they each had their own ulterior motives and wanted to kill the other party. In the novel, Xu Qi 'an appeared to be a playboy, but in fact, he was a brave and resourceful man with a heart for the world, and his father was a man who was strict on the surface but loved his son very much in his heart. As both of them had their own secrets and goals, they looked very harmonious on the surface, but in fact, they were full of schemes and schemes.
Because of the novel's compact plot and distinct characters, the phrase "Da Feng's watchman, a benevolent father, and a filial son" was also used to describe other similar situations, such as the father and son who seemed to be in harmony on the surface but actually had their own plans.

The literary image refers to the characters in the literary works, including the characters, scenes, plots, etc. in the novel.
The following are some of the characteristics of literary images:
1. Personal characteristics: literary images usually have distinct personal characteristics, including personality, thoughts, emotions, attitudes, etc. These characteristics could be directly described or indirectly expressed through words, actions, appearance, etc.
2. Physical characteristics: literary images usually have realistic physical characteristics, including the character's clothing, hairstyle, accessories, body proportions, etc. These characteristics could be expressed through painting, photography, and other methods to make the character's image more vivid.
3. Psychological characteristics: literary images usually have profound psychological characteristics, including the thoughts, feelings, emotions, etc. of the characters. These characteristics could be expressed through the dialogue and behavior of the character to make the character more realistic.
4. Situation characteristics: literary images usually have realistic situation characteristics, including scenes, atmosphere, etc. These characteristics could be expressed through descriptions and other means to make the characters more vivid.
5. Language features: The language features of literary images include diction, grammar, tone, etc. These characteristics could be expressed through the character's language, dialogue, and other means to make the character's image more distinct.
The literary image is an important part of the literary works. It provides readers with a rich imagination and reading experience by shaping the distinct characters to show the profound theme and meaning.
